Abstract

Methods and kits for predicting infusion reaction risk and antibody-mediated loss of response during intravenous PEGylated uricase therapy in gout patients is provided. Routine SUA monitoring can be used to identify patients receiving PEGylated uricase who may no longer benefit from treatment and who are at greater risk for infusion reactions.

1 . A method of lowering the risk of an infusion reaction while treating chronic gout refractory to conventional therapy in a patient, the method comprising:

a. intravenously administering to the patient a PEGylated uricase protein every 2 or every 4 weeks;

b. measuring the serum uric acid level of the patient after each said administration; and

c. either continuing to administer the PEGylated uricase protein if the patient's serum uric acid is measured to be less than 6 mg/dl, or discontinuing administration of the PEGylated uricase protein if the patient's serum uric acid level is measured to be at least 6 mg/dl, thereby lowering the risk of an infusion reaction;

wherein the PEGylated uricase protein is selected from the group consisting of an Aspergillus flavus uricase that has been PEGylated, an Arthrobacter globiformis uricase that has been PEGylated, a Candida utilis uricase that has been PEGylated, and pegloticase; and

wherein each polyethylene glycol (PEG) molecule of the PEGylated uricase has a molecular weight between 1 kDa and 50 kDa.
